Padres tie game twice, on homer by Trent Grisham and single by Jurickson Profar, but Mets pull away in seventh
Tedious and tense at the same time, everything matters and everything is remembered.had a chance Saturday night to close out their National League wild-card series against the Mets. They did not.They came back from a one-run deficit to tie the game twice, but they never led and ultimately fell 7-3 at rollicking Citi Field.
Padres’ Trent Grisham takes a photo with Mike Clevinger in the dugout after hitting a solo home run in the third inning. Still, Mets manager Buck Showalter stuck with Diaz. The right-hander retired Manny Machado on two pitches before walking Josh Bell on four. He was removed after striking out Cronenworth on three pitches to bring his total to for the game to 28.Showalter then went to Adam Ottavino , who ended the inning by striking out Drury but was unable to finish the ninth, loading the bases on two walks and a hit batter, and then walking Machado to force in a run.
